A manager at one of Huddersfield’s leading private day nurseries has stepped down after 25 years. Samantha Richmond leaves Oakwood House Nursery & Forest School in Edgerton to be replaced by experienced childcare professional Gail Howarth.

Oakwood House is part of the Portland Nurseries group which has four sites across Lindley, Edgerton and Birkby.

Samantha joined in 1996 working with then owner and founder Rosemary Murphy OBE, who founded the National Day Nurseries Association. Samantha helped grow the company, progressing her career from Baby Room Leader at Portland House in Lindley, to Manager at Oakwood House - a post she has held since the imposing Edgerton villa was purchased by the group 11 years ago.

Over her distinguished career Samantha has touched the lives of hundreds of families across Huddersfield and has received multiple Ofsted ‘Outstanding’ inspections, with inspectors citing: “Inspirational leadership with well-qualified staff group who work very enthusiastically as a team. This means children are provided with the very best learning experiences.”

Samantha will take up a part time role as Training and Management Coordinator. Gail Howarth takes the reins as manager at Oakwood House, bringing with her vast experience of working across multiple sites and geographic locations, including Colchester, Cyprus and Edinburgh as Nursery Manager and Nursery Principal.
